Where is Lānaʻi?
Imagine a beautiful island in the middle of the big blue Pacific Ocean. That's Lānaʻi! It's part of the amazing Hawaiian Islands.
It's not the biggest island, but it's the smallest one you can visit easily. It sits between two other islands, Molokaʻi and Maui, like a secret hideaway. The water around it is called a channel, which is like a watery path connecting the islands.
It's a special place with lots of sunshine and warm breezes.
The Island That Grew Pineapples!
Once upon a time, Lānaʻi was like a giant pineapple farm! It was covered in fields of sweet, juicy pineapples. That's why people call it the 'Pineapple Island.' Now, there aren't as many pineapples, but the island still remembers its yummy past.
It's a place where nature is very important, and many of the roads are made of dirt, so you need a special car to explore everywhere. It's like a real adventure waiting to happen!
Living on Lānaʻi
Only a few people live on Lānaʻi, in a small town called Lānaʻi City. It's so peaceful there that there are no traffic lights! Everyone knows each other, and it feels like a big family.
Kids go to one school that has all the grades, from kindergarten to high school. There's also a small hospital to help everyone stay healthy. It’s a cozy place where life moves at a gentle pace, surrounded by beautiful nature.
Fun Facts About Lānaʻi!
Did you know that most of Lānaʻi is owned by just one person? It's true! Also, to get to some of the most amazing spots on the island, you need a four-wheel-drive car because the roads are bumpy and made of dirt. It's like a treasure hunt to find hidden beaches and cool views. Lānaʻi is a place full of surprises and natural beauty, waiting for you to discover its secrets.
